Transaction 8950470d9ef41b7632f7f8ce952fa3714229289d15aa4d6d7bed51ac212b481a

1 Input
2 Outputs
  • 8950470d9ef41b7632f7f8ce952fa3714229289d15aa4d6d7bed51ac212b481a:0
  • value  2584688
    address  3Ak7W2LAM6ZzRKYMcMrmnDrQwFiip9L3jg
  • 8950470d9ef41b7632f7f8ce952fa3714229289d15aa4d6d7bed51ac212b481a:1
  • value  29275
    address  33fvMJc2MHHTfRU2mKHdS6PAyP17H3b1Ze